Founded in 1918, the Nencki Institute of Experimental Biology of the Polish Academy of Science is currently the largest non-university biological research centre in Poland. The Institute focuses on issues directly related to health protection and improving the quality of life.

Why study at Nencki Institute of Experimental Biology? The Institute’s main mission is to learn the mechanisms and develop innovative therapies and diagnostic methods for cancer, diabetes, neurodegenerative diseases, neurological disorders and other civilization diseases.
